Output 65d478eb28110ca646c31f3bfc2414962c4cd2b0437639d0ee643d1660dedebd:0

value
3868565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df3e4af5090e8c28d0ffe5ae17341abbe414d35c OP_EQUALVERIFY OP_CHECKSIG
address
1MMQJxZPwhRBxRs6FFKdu5vSp361eSyTzk
transaction
65d478eb28110ca646c31f3bfc2414962c4cd2b0437639d0ee643d1660dedebd
confirmations
306668
spent
true